Especificações
| Atributo | Valor |
| PartStatus | Active |
| FilterType | Band Pass |
| Frequency-CutofforCenter | 1.95GHz ~ 3.4GHz |
| NumberofFilters | 1 |
| Voltage-Supply | 0V ~ 14V |
| MountingType | Surface Mount |
| Package/Case | 32-WFQFN Exposed Pad, CSP |
| SupplierDevicePackage | 32-LFCSP (5x5) |
| BaseProductNumber | HMC891 |

Features
Key features include a control voltage input for frequency tuning, allowing the user to adjust the center frequency as needed. The HMC891ALP5E is packaged in a compact 5x5 mm plastic leadless surface-mount package, which facilitates easy integration into various circuit designs. Its small form factor and high performance make it ideal for applications requiring compact and efficient RF filtering solutions. Additionally, the filter boasts good linearity and power handling capabilities, further enhancing its utility in demanding RF environments. Overall, the HMC891ALP5E is a reliable choice for applications requiring precise and adjustable band pass filtering.

Application
1. Wireless Infrastructure: Supports signal processing in base stations and wireless communication networks.
2. Test and Measurement Equipment: Used in devices that measure and test RF signals.
3. Military and Aerospace: Suitable for secure communication systems and radar applications.
4. Satellite Communications: Facilitates frequency translation and signal conditioning in satellite systems.
5. Broadband Communications: Enhances performance in broadband networks through filtering and frequency management.
These application areas leverage the HMC891ALP5E's capabilities in high-frequency signal processing and filtering.
